Helzer Ties UDM Rookie Mark In Top-20 Finish At Marshall

Freshman Christian Helzer tied the Titan rookie record at Marshall.
HUNTINGTON, W Va. (9/15/2026) -- University of Detroit Mercy men's golf freshman Christian Helzer put his name in the record book in just his second collegiate start, and the Titans posted one of their best scores in school history as the Joe Feaganes Marshall Invitational came to an end on Tuesday.

Detroit Mercy finished ninth with an 860 (287-285-288) at the par 71, 6,523-yard Guyan Country Club in Huntington, West Virginia. The 860 team card is now sixth in school history and the best 54-hole score since 2007. 

Helzer wrapped up a great tournament with a 3-over 74 to share 17th with a 211 (71-66-74), tied for 11th in the school record book and tying the UDM rookie record with Brent McClung's 211 (69-68-74) at the Ohio Collegiate Classic in 2000.

After tying for third in school history with a 5-under 66 in round two, Helzer registered four birdies and seven pars on the final 18 to earn the top-20 finish. He tied for eighth on the course's par 5's with a -4, 4.56 average and tied for 10th with 12 total birdies.

Playing as an individual, sophomore Peyton Lawley tied for 37th with a career-low 216 (75-68-73) as he knocked in three birdies and 11 pars for a 2-over 73 in the final round. Overall, he had 11 birdies and 30 pars.

Senior Mason Sokolowski finished 41st after posting a 217 (74-72-71), lowering his score for the third straight round with an even 71, tallying two birdies and 14 pars. He tied for 11th with a 3.08 average on the par 3's and tied for first in the field with 40 pars. 

Senior David Swab shared 47th with a 218 (74-74-70) after carding the best Titan round of the day with a 1-under 70. He started the final 18 with nine straight pars and ended it with two birdies and six pars after his lone blemish of a bogey. He also tied for third among the competition with 39 pars in the event.

Senior Ethan Oblak shot a 220 (68-73-79) and tied for 61st, while senior Gowtham Nalluri placed 76th with a 223 (75-75-73).

The Titans will have a few weeks of practice before their next event in Cleveland State's Tom Tontimonia Invitational, Oct. 5-6.
